Pros and cons of custom kitchen cabinets
Custom kitchen cabinets are the form that have been designed and planned specifically for
your home and then created based on those specifications. They give you the largest selection of different
types of materials, sizes, shapes, styles, and other choices. Custom kitchen cabinets also give that extra
little bit of specially tailored flair that will ensure that the cabinetry will perfectly suit your style, colors,
and decorating.
Because they are made from scratch for you, they will come with a warranty for a certain length of time.
That said, as custom kitchen cabinets are created just for your home, it can take one or two months – on average –
for them to be ready to be installed, and can be notably more expensive than stock products.
Pros and cons of semi custom kitchen cabinets
Semi custom kitchen cabinets are produced within a factory and come in a limited number of pre-determined sizes,
but offer a certain quantity of customizable options from which you can choose. The most popular materials
for semi custom kitchen cabinets are maple, hickory, pecan, pine, oak, and cherry woods. Though they are
manufactured to be a certain size, they can be altered to better fit the room. Average delivery time for semi
custom kitchen cabinets is between four and six weeks, which is only slightly less than full custom kitchen
cabinets. Though they are not as expensive as their counterparts made completely from scratch, they are
pricier than stock products.
Pros and cons of stock cabinetry
Unlike custom kitchen cabinets, stock items are much more affordable. They are typically manufactured from
particleboard with different types of colors and wood finishes as well as in a variety of styles. The most
popular types of stock cabinetry are maple, oak, and cherry woods. Though they are available in standard
sizes, these cannot be altered. Your choice is limited to the retailer’s inventory. That said, there is
no waiting time before these products are ready. Any waiting is based exclusively on delivery schedules.
